Vital Link Satellite LLC
Business: Media / Entertainment / Sports | Satellite/Cable TV
Recent News About Vital Link Satellite LLC
Tuesday, April 1, 2025
Business: Media / Entertainment / Sports | Satellite/Cable TV
Recent News About Vital Link Satellite LLC